KARL MAYER
k.management | Live-Monitoring
KARL MAYER developed various apps based on the ADAMOS IIoT technology, such as the k.management app. These apps enable machines to be monitored live and key figures such as machine speed, output, availability and performance to be displayed directly on the customer's mobile device.

DÜRR Systems
DXQequipment.analytics | Smart paint shops
With DXQequipment.analytics DÜRR has developed a software based on the ADAMOS IIoT technology, which collects, evaluates and visualizes robot and process data. This enables processes to be designed more efficiently, faults to be eliminated, maintenance work to be supported and product quality to be ensured.

Mayer & Cie. & MeetNow!
knitlink | Machine and customer portal
Since summer 2019, Mayer & Cie. has been offering a platform for recording and evaluating machine data: knitlink. The machine portal knitlink is a comprehensive cloud information system based on the ADAMOS IIoT platform, allowing Mayer & Cie. to offer customers all services and future digital products via one platform.

ILLIG & elunic
ILLIG Assist | Digital service platform
ILLIG Maschinenbau together with our Enabling Partner elunic has developed the digital service platform ILLIG Assist based on the ADAMOS IIoT platform. Thanks to seamless communication between machines and operators, events can be eliminated by digital messages and digital knowledge transfer via an interactive user interface.

ADAMOS & Partner
Digital Workpiece | Workpiece Management
Together with its partners, ADAMOS has developed the app 'Digital Workpiece' based on the results of the first Hackathon. The app organizes workpiece data from different machines and across different production steps and assigns them to a specific workpiece. The ADAMOS IIoT platform is the technological basis.
